自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(13)
  • 收藏
  • 关注

原创 Datawhale-Git教程-Task3

五章&六章.git 文件夹下objects文件夹中存储三种对象 分别是数据对象(blob),树对象(tree)和提交对象(commit)objects文件夹中生成的文件校验和即 SHA-1 哈希值会被分成两部分,前两个字符作为文件夹名,后38位作为文件名可以使用git cat-file -t SHA-1哈希值来查看存储的内容及存储类型git gc可以手动将多个对象打包成一个称为"包文件",并记录下其内容(.pack)和偏移量(.idx)作为文件保存在pack文件夹下...

2022-05-22 19:50:17 86

原创 Datawhale-Git教程-Task2

三章&四章git branch可以查看当前项目拥有的全部分支,其中一个分支前带 * 号的就是当前所在的分支。git branch 分支名可以创建新的分支,但是当前所在分支不会改变git checkout 分支名来切换到其他分支git log --oneline可以查看此文件各分支的提交记录git merge 分支名可以合并分支,但是如果在两个分支中对同一文件进行了修改,就会合并失败并需要人工选择需要合并/舍弃的部分git remote -v查看远程库的origin地址从本地推送到远程

2022-05-19 23:04:00 112

原创 Datawhale-Git教程-Task1

一章&二章版本控制系统可以分为集中式版本控制系统和分布式版本控制系统。集中式版本控制系统分布式版本控制系统版本库集中存放在中央服务器为台PC机里都有完整的版本库版本库→仓库 版本库中文件的各种操作都会被Git追踪,并可以在未来的某一个时间段被还原获取Git仓库可以将尚未进行版本控制的本地目录转换为 Git 仓库,也可以从其它服务器克隆一个已存在的 Git 仓库在已存在目录中初始化仓库克隆现有的仓库git initgit add <

2022-05-17 23:01:36 115

原创 Datawhale-动手学数据分析-Task5

模型搭建和评估【思考】这些库的作用是什么呢?:pandas: 用于数据分析、数据挖掘、数据清洗matplotlib: 用于数据可视化seaborn: 基于 matplotlib 的统计图制作库Ipython.display.Image:直接使用 IPython.display 类的 Image 打开图片, 再 display清洗后的数据比原始数据缺少了姓名和船票信息,这些数据与存活概率无相关性监督学习:训练样本有标记无监督学习:训练样本无标记【思考】划分数据集的方法有哪些?:留出法、交

2022-03-25 00:55:13 1493 1

原创 Datawhale-动手学数据分析-Task4

数据可视化matplotlib可以画如下几种类型的图折线图散点图柱状图直方图饼图…可以使用 plt.xlabel() 和 plt.ylabel() 来设置X轴和Y轴的标签可以使用 plt.title() 来设置图标的标题👆面三个方法还提供了 loc 参数来改变文字部分的位置,可选 left,right,center(default)【思考】看到男女生还人数第一感受:女性存活人数多,但还是要看占比。plt.grid() 函数可以通过设置参数来显示网格线,并且可以设置不同样式的网格

2022-03-22 00:15:11 1240

原创 Datawhale-动手学数据分析-Task3

这次是拿板子写的

2022-03-19 23:33:30 152

原创 Datawhale-动手学数据分析-Task2

第二章数据清理及特征处理.dropna() 函数 官方文档🔗DataFrame.dropna(axis=0, how='any', thresh=None, subset=None, inplace=False)参数功能axisaxis 确定是否删除包含缺失值的行或列axis = 0 时删除包含缺失值的行(默认值)axis = 1 时删除包含缺失值的列howhow 确定是行/列中均为 NaN 或者有 NaN 就将此行/列删去 how = 'any' 时删除有缺失值

2022-03-17 23:53:07 1081

原创 Datawhale-动手学数据分析-Task1

第一章第一小节使用 os.getcwd() 时需要 import os 即导入操作系统接口模块来查看当前工作路径。pd.read_csv()pd.read_table()加载带分隔符的数据,默认分隔符是逗号(,)加载带分割符的数据,默认分隔符是制表符(\t)读出的数据一行为一个列表,列表里每个字符串自成一列读出的数据一行为一个列表,列表里为一列包含该行所有数据的字符串.csv(comma separated values) 逗号分隔值.tsv(tab s

2022-03-16 00:10:28 567

原创 LeetCode189-轮转数组

题干给你一个数组,将数组中的元素向右轮转 k 个位置,其中 k 是非负数。示例 1:输入: nums = [1,2,3,4,5,6,7], k = 3输出: [5,6,7,1,2,3,4]解释:向右轮转 1 步: [7,1,2,3,4,5,6]向右轮转 2 步: [6,7,1,2,3,4,5]向右轮转 3 步: [5,6,7,1,2,3,4]示例 2:输入:nums = [-1,-100,3,99], k = 2输出:[3,99,-1,-100]解释:向右轮转 1 步: [99,-

2021-12-18 22:45:23 128

原创 信奥一本通-动态规划-例9.2-数字金字塔-方法四-逆推法代码实现

#include<bits/stdc++.h>using namespace std;int main(){ //x y分别为行列 int x, y; //金字塔的高度 int n; cin >> n; //a[][][1]表示数据本身 //a[][][2]表示与下层相加之后的最大和 //a[][][3]表示前往下一层是不变(0)还是向右(1) int a[51][51][4]; memset(

2021-11-29 20:15:53 536

原创 1002 写出这个数

开始时想用C语言写 后来觉得switch好长一溜(而且写完还一堆bug后面看带佬代码用二维数组才发觉用switch好傻写了个cpp版的思路:首先需要一个容器把需要输出的拼音装进去由于不知道测试输入的具体个数,需要有一个操作终止输入输入的是字符型数据,需要减去0对应的ASC码才是想要的数字if判断开始觉得没有必要,for中的条件判断就能够满足,但是等执行完第一个for循环之后sum的值都会变成个位数string的输出有些问题 在用printf输出会变成乱码 改成了cout尝试在拼音后加空格

2021-09-06 20:26:45 45

原创 1001 害死人不偿命的(3n+1)猜想

首先 根据题目要求 就是if else的双选择类型,最开始选择的是do while循环 提交时发现最后一个测试答案错误 只有一处错误那应该就是临界值的问题 尝试后发现 使用do while会先无条件进入循环 那样就导致原本可以直接输出count=0的1结果错误 换成while就解决了这个问题感觉这道题还可以使用递归 等有空补上`#include<stdio.h>int main(){ int num, count=0; if(scanf("%d",&num)){

2021-09-06 19:48:32 40

原创 黑色星期五(七周5.4.2)

题目黑色星期五在西方,星期五和数字13都代表着坏运气,两个不幸的个体最后结合成超级不幸的一天。所以,不管哪个月的13日又恰逢星期五就叫“黑色星期五”。如果只告诉你年号和该年的元旦是星期几(1-7),你能找出该年所有的“黑色星期五”(年/月/日)吗?。以下是调试没有通过的程序,请完善并给出结果。输入:4位年号和该年元旦是星期几输出:所有的“黑色星期五”的日期(年/月/日)样例输入:2006 7输出:2006/1/132006/10/13```c#include<stdio.h

2021-04-17 18:19:49 867

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除